Outsource Web Development: A Comprehensive Guide for Your Business

As businesses strive to stay competitive in the ever-evolving digital landscape, outsource web development has emerged as a key strategy for achieving efficiency, innovation, and cost savings. In this extensive guide, we will explore the benefits of outsourcing web development, the process of selecting the right partner, and the various considerations that can enhance your business’s online presence.
Understanding Outsourced Web Development
Outsourcing web development involves hiring external service providers to handle some or all of your website's development needs. This can include anything from designing a new website to developing complex applications. The rise of remote work and global connectivity has made it easier than ever to find qualified web development teams around the world, especially in regions with a strong tech industry.
The Benefits of Outsourcing Web Development
Choosing to outsource web development can offer numerous advantages that can significantly impact your business's growth trajectory. Here are some key benefits:
- Cost Efficiency: By outsourcing, businesses can reduce expenses associated with hiring a full-time development team. Companies can pay only for the work that is done and often at a lower rate than local talent.
- Access to Global Talent: Outsourcing opens the door to a global talent pool. Businesses can find specialized skills that may not be available in their local market, ensuring high-quality outcomes.
- Focus on Core Competencies: Outsourcing allows companies to focus on their core business activities while leaving web development to the experts. This can enhance productivity and free up internal resources.
- Scalability: As projects grow or evolve, outsourced teams can quickly scale their services, providing the necessary manpower without the hassle of recruitment and training.
- Faster Time to Market: With a dedicated team working on development, companies can accelerate the development process, enabling quicker launch times for new features and products.
Key Considerations When Outsourcing Web Development
While the benefits are clear, outsourcing web development also comes with its own set of challenges. Here are some critical considerations to keep in mind:
1. Define Your Objectives
Before seeking an outsourcing partner, it's crucial to clearly define your project goals, timelines, and budget. Understanding your needs will not only streamline the selection process but also establish expectations for both parties.
2. Assessing Potential Partners
When looking to outsource, take the time to research potential development partners. Consider their experience, portfolio, and client testimonials. A well-rounded portfolio showcasing successful projects can help you gauge their capabilities.
3. Communication is Key
Effective communication is essential for successful collaboration. Establish channels for regular updates, feedback, and discussions. Using project management tools can enhance transparency and keep everyone aligned on progress.
4. Understanding Different Models
Outsourcing can take various forms, such as:
- Freelancers: Independent contractors who can be hired on a project basis.
- Dedicated Teams: Full teams that can be hired to work solely on your project for an extended period.
- Agencies: Companies that provide a range of services, including design, development, and marketing.
Choosing the Right Outsourcing Model
The right outsourcing model depends on your specific project requirements. Here’s a brief overview of each model:
Freelancers
Freelancers can be a cost-effective solution for smaller projects or specific tasks. They offer flexibility and can often start working immediately. However, they may lack the resources for larger, more complex projects.
Dedicated Teams
Employing a dedicated team offers a balanced approach for mid-sized to extensive projects. This model allows for cohesive development with a focus on your company’s project. It generally results in better quality output due to a committed team.
Agencies
Agencies provide a comprehensive service package that typically includes project management, design, and development. They may be more expensive than freelancers, but their expertise often leads to higher quality work and faster completion times.
Finding the Best Outsourcing Partner
Finding the right partner for your outsourced web development needs can make all the difference. Here are some tips to help you make the best choice:
1. Verify Credentials and Expertise
Check the technical skills and qualifications of your potential partner. Look for teams that specialize in the technologies and platforms relevant to your project, such as HTML, CSS, JavaScript, or specific CMS platforms like WordPress or Magento.
2. Review Past Work
Examining a potential partner’s portfolio is critical in assessing their capabilities. Look for projects similar to your own in both size and scope. Pay attention to the quality of their work and user feedback.
3. Ask for References
Don't hesitate to ask potential partners for references from previous clients. Speaking to past customers can provide insights into how reliable, efficient, and communicative a company is.
4. Communication and Cultural Fit
Strong communication is vital, especially when working with teams in different time zones or countries. Ensure that the partner's communication style aligns with your company's culture to foster a productive working relationship.
Managing an Outsourced Web Development Project
Once you’ve selected an outsourcing partner, effective management is essential for ensuring a successful project. Here are some best practices:
1. Set Clear Milestones and Expectations
Outline the project timeline, deliverables, and performance metrics at the project's start. Setting clear milestones can help track progress and ensure that the project stays on track.
2. Foster Open Communication
Regular check-ins and updates encourage open dialogue. Schedule weekly meetings to discuss project status, address concerns, and review upcoming tasks.
3. Use Project Management Tools
Utilize tools like Trello, Asana, or Jira to manage tasks, assign responsibilities, and track progress. These platforms help improve efficiency and accountability.
Capitalizing on Outsourcing Beyond Web Development
The advantages of outsourcing extend beyond just web development. Businesses can consider leveraging outsourcing for various aspects of their operations, including:
- IT Services: Outsourcing IT support can enhance infrastructure and security without the cost of in-house staff.
- Graphic Design: Engaging freelance designers or agencies can help maintain a professional brand image across your marketing materials.
- Content Creation: Hiring content writers can improve your SEO strategy and attract more visitors to your site.
Conclusion: The Future of Web Development Outsourcing
In the fast-paced world of digital business, the choice to outsource web development is not merely a trend, but a strategic decision that many companies are making to enhance operational efficiency and drive growth. As technology continues to evolve, outsourcing allows businesses to remain at the forefront of innovation while minimizing costs. By understanding the benefits, selecting the right partner, and managing the project effectively, businesses can leverage outsourcing to achieve remarkable success.
As a digital agency at Thomas Design, we specialize in IT services, graphic design, and web design, providing comprehensive solutions tailored to our clients’ unique needs. Embrace the future of your business with strategic outsourcing and watch your online presence soar.